Best in Care - Centennial Issue - (Page 14) GIVING BACK By the Book S Florida Hospital helps Central Florida get healthy ince 1908, the heart and soul of Florida Hospital has been its mission—to extend the healing ministry of Christ—not only through words but by creating healthier communities. Every year Florida Hospital gives back through care for those in need, special programs for those at risk, partnerships with health and social service organizations, and more. With alarming rates of obesity, heart disease, cancer, stroke and diabetes in Central Florida, Florida Hospital has launched several educational health programs this year to reverse these startling trends and improve the health of the community. This community wellness program is designed to promote healthier lifestyles through education and chronic-disease self-management. Apopka has a higher percentage of people dying from heart disease, cancer, stroke and diabetes than all of Orange County, according to Florida Vital Statistics. It also has a higher percentage of obesity, according to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. The Heart of Apopka is aimed at significantly affecting the health of 10,000 Apopka citizens. A community health initiative in the East Orlando area, Cuidate focuses on educating Hispanic area residents on chronic diseases and healthy lifestyle changes. Free training, health information, community outreach and clinics are components of the program that is in collaboration among: Florida Hospital, Hispanic Chamber of Commerce of Metro Orlando, East Orlando Chamber of Commerce, Primary Care Access Network, University of Central Florida and the Orange County Health Department. Florida Hospital has launched the SuperFit Family Challenge eight-week program to encourage families to get healthy. Based on Florida Hospital’s Amazon.com bestseller, SuperSized Kids, the program teaches families how to avoid the No. 1 family health crisis facing them today— obesity. This step-by-step, medically sound weightcontrol program is designed for the whole family and is being used nationwide by corporations, schools, churches and other communities.
